Sundariya - Danta Ramgarh, Sikar

Sundariya is a village situated in the Danta Ramgarh tehsil of Sikar district, Rajasthan. It is located approximately 8 km from the tehsil headquarters in Danta Ramgarh and around 58 km from the district headquarters in Sikar. Motlawas serves as the Gram Panchayat for Sundariya village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Sundariya is 081864. The village covers a total geographical area of 324 hectares and falls under the 332702 pincode. Sikar is the nearest town, located about 58 km away.

Sundariya village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Danta ramgarh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Sikar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Sundariya

As per Census 2011, Sundariya village has a total population of 782 people, consisting of 385 males and 397 females. The village has 112 households and a sex ratio of 1,031 females per 1,000 males. There are 126 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 412 literate and 370 illiterate residents. Additionally, 25 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Sundariya

Public transport in the Sundariya is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Pacharmalikpura, while the nearest airport is Jaipur International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 62.3 km.
